What is bar?
Bar is a unit of pressure equal to one hundred kilopascals. It is commonly used in engineering and fluid dynamics to quantify pressure and stress levels.
What is Inch of mercury?
Inch of mercury is a unit of pressure equal to the pressure exerted by a column of mercury one inch high. It is commonly used in barometers and vacuum gauges to measure atmospheric pressure.
